The Indian Premier League (IPL) 2024 season wrapped up in thrilling fashion, with the Kolkata Knight Riders (KKR) emerging as champions for the third time. Their victory was not just a matter of prestige, as it also came with a substantial financial reward of INR 20 crore. The Sunrisers Hyderabad (SRH), who finished as runners-up, were awarded INR 13 crore. The total prize pool for the IPL 2024 season was INR 46.5 crore, which was distributed among various teams and individual performers.

Prize Money Allocation

  • Champions (KKR): INR 20 crore
  • Runners-Up (SRH): INR 13 crore
  • Third Place (Rajasthan Royals): INR 7 crore
  • Fourth Place (Royal Challengers Bangalore): INR 6.5 crore

Individual Awards and Prizes

The IPL also recognized outstanding individual performances throughout the season with various awards:

  • Orange Cap: Virat Kohli (RCB) – 741 runs (Prize: Rs 10 lakh)
  • Kohli’s stellar performance included a century and five fifties, finishing with an average of 61.75 and a strike rate of 154.69.
  • Purple Cap: Harshal Patel (Punjab Kings) – 24 wickets (Prize: Rs 10 lakh)
  • Harshal’s remarkable bowling figures included an economy rate of 9.73 and an average of 19.87 over 14 matches.
  • Most Valuable Player of the Season: Sunil Narine (KKR) (Prize: Rs 12 lakh)
  • Ultimate Fantasy Player of the Season: Sunil Narine (KKR)
  • Most 4s: Travis Head (64)
  • Most 6s: Abhishek Sharma (42)
  • Striker of the Season: Jake Fraser-McGurk (Strike rate: 234.04)
  • Emerging Player of the Season: Nitish Kumar Reddy (SRH) (Prize: Rs 20 lakh)
  • Catch of the Season: Ramandeep Singh
  • Fair Play Award: Sunrisers Hyderabad
  • Pitch and Ground Award: Hyderabad Cricket Association

Detailed Performance Highlights

Virat Kohli’s Outstanding Season:
Virat Kohli, playing for Royal Challengers Bangalore, once again showcased his batting prowess by scoring 741 runs in 15 matches. His exceptional performance included a best score of 113* and a consistent strike rate of 154.69, marking his highest in any IPL season to date.

Harshal Patel’s Bowling Excellence:
Punjab Kings’ Harshal Patel claimed the Purple Cap with 24 wickets in 14 matches. His ability to take crucial wickets while maintaining a respectable economy rate of 9.73 was instrumental in his team’s bowling attack.

Sunil Narine’s Versatility:
Sunil Narine of Kolkata Knight Riders proved his worth as the most valuable player and the ultimate fantasy player, contributing significantly with both bat and ball. His all-around performance was a key factor in KKR’s successful campaign.

Emerging Talent:
Nitish Kumar Reddy of Sunrisers Hyderabad was named the Emerging Player of the Season for his impressive all-around contributions, indicating a promising future in cricket.
